China Village Restaurant
Home
>
China Village Restaurant
>
Indiana
China Village Restaurant stores in Indiana
China Village Restaurant - Newburgh
8423 Bell Oaks Dr, Newburgh, IN 47630
China Village Restaurant - Indiana
Number of stores: 1
State:
Indiana
change state
Cities
Newburgh
China Village Restaurant jobs in Indiana